1561 Centre St sits in Boston, near the intersection of South Street and Washington Street. The nearby Charles River adds to the area's charm. Public transportation makes travel around the city simple. A park nearby provides space for outdoor activities and leisure. The low-rise building consists of one story with 10 condominium units. Construction finished in 1937. Unit sizes range from 839 to 1,147 square feet. Options include 1, 2, and 3-bedroom layouts. Each living space is designed for comfort and practicality. Unit prices vary between $355,000 and $365,000. Recent sales show strong interest in these homes. Prices reflect the value of the area and the quality of the building. This makes it a good choice for many buyers. Nearby, grocery needs can be met at 7-Eleven or Henry's Market. For dining, Prime Time Pizza & Subs offers a local spot for casual meals. These amenities support daily living and add to the community feel. The building also includes features like hot water access and golf amenities. Residents benefit from convenient transportation options. The architecture of the building carries a classic style that fits well with the neighborhood. This location combines a relaxed vibe with city accessibility.

Roslindale is a Boston neighborhood with a lively village center. The area mixes small shops, cafes, and varied restaurants along walkable streets. It has parks, playgrounds, green space for outdoor time, and a weekly farmers market with regular local events. You can find a public library and basic services like banks, grocery stores, and schools. Local shops host art shows and small festivals on weekends. Transit options include bus routes and commuter rail links into downtown Boston. The area sits near major roads for convenient car access.

This neighborhood indicates a good mix of people which makes it a good place for families. About 17.85% are children aged 0–14, 14.64% are young adults between 15–29, 26.69% are adults aged 30–44, 20.08% are in the 45–59 range and 20.74% are seniors aged 60 and above. Commuting options are also varying where 60.26% of residents relying on driving, while others prefer public transit around 19.35%, walking around 3.05%, biking around 1.8%, allowing residents to choose travel modes that best fit their daily routines. Most homes in the area are with 58.48% of units owner occupied and 41.52% are rented. The neighborhood offers different household types. About 32.47% are single family homes and 7.25% are multi family units. Around 26.95% are single-person households, while 73.05% are multi person households. This mix works well for families, roommates, and individuals. Education levels in the neighborhood vary widely where 27.78% of residents have bachelor’s degrees. Around 15.25% have high school or college education. Another 5.31% hold diplomas while 33.64% have completed postgraduate studies. The remaining are 18.02% with other types of qualifications.
